Business Administration apprenticeship

Work as part of the reception team in a professional manner to provide high quality reception and support services to patients, visitors, GPs and allied professionals. Follow all relevant standard operating prdures, policies and charters to ensure working in an efficient and courteous manner at all times.

Key Duties:Admin Duties:

Receive and greet patients, i.e. patients and visitors to the Practice, in a welcoming and professional manner Answer telephone calls in a professional manner ensuring important/appropriate information is documented and redirected accordingly Complete eConsult in a timely and efficient manner, using knowledge of in hours and local services to signpost where appropriate Provide accurate and up to date information to answer the enquiries of patients and visitors where necessary seeking the advice of others, responding to and/or redirect all patient and visitor requests accordingly. Accurately maintain and update appointment systems, booking in patients and visitors in line with practice appointments and visitors procedures Accurately maintain and update both computerised and manual filing systems, including: setting up new patient records on the clinical system; updating of patient details; entry of identified clinical data (including read codes) to medical records; electronic scanning of correspondences and allocation to patient records Coordinate and arrange support services including interpreting services. Ensure reception and waiting areas are maintained in a clean and tidy state, preparing and tidying rest and meeting areas, when requested, including the making of drinks and using dishwasher. Open and lock up the Reception area at the beginning and end of the day and to ensure the building is secure each evening before leaving and ensuring the premises are adequately alarmed. Arrange for an ambulance for patients as and when requested by the clinician. Notify the team leader of any equipment or IT failures or faulty equipment. Attend meetings as required, e.g. business meeting, reception meeting and all PLT sessions. Provide guidance and training to new members of staff to help them achieve their objectives. Ensure all individually attended training sessions are cascaded to all members of the reception team. To maintain patient and staff confidentiality all times including outside of the work environment. To provide holiday and sickness cover for reception and other administration duties as required To undertake any other duties commensurate with the scope of the role and within your skill set as requested. Employer Description:

Firdale Medical Centre is a General Practitioner (GP) surgery in Northwich, Cheshire, part of the NHS, providing routine and chronic disease management, mental health support, family planning, and immunizations, known as a teaching practice that trains future doctors and offers extended hours and online booking for patient convenience.
